Kingdom Heirs Announce New Baritone

The Kingdom Heirs are very happy to announce the hiring of Brian Alvey as their new baritone singer. Kries French, owner/manger of the Kingdom Heirs states "A lot of prayer and consideration went into our decision and we are thrilled to welcome Brian and his family, into our family."
French continues, "During our time on the road this winter, we had the privilege to audition close to 60 men who traveled many miles for this chance and we thank each of you so much. We feel that God has led us to the man He wants for us."
"We are honored to have entered our 30th year of partnership with The Kingdom Heirs", states Sonlite records President Chris White. "We are excited to continue this relationship with a new recording the group is already working on for an October release."
The Kingdom Heirs ask you to please help us in welcoming Brian and his family to the Kingdom Heir family. Brian will start his tenure with the group at Dollywood immediately. The Kingdom Heirs would like to invite everyone to come and experience this new era of music and ministry.
